
Could it have been hubbub surrounding the recent Hulu series about their mom and dad’s infamous sex tape that first attracted a buyer? Or was it that the place was featured in an MTV reality show? Or both? Or neither?
We may never know, but TMZ has reported that someone liked the Malibu home of Brandon Thomas and Dylan Jagger Lee so much they’ve snapped it up for exactly $3 million, netting the siblings a cool $1 million more than they paid for the place, back in 2018.
Still best known as the sons of Mötley Crüe drummer Tommy Lee and his ex-wife Pamela Anderson of “Baywatch” fame, 25-year-old Brandon and Dylan, 24, have managed to carve out successful careers of their own — the former as a model and reality TV personality on “The Hills: New Beginnings,” and the latter as a model and musician in the band Motel 7.
Tucked away on a heavily wooded hillside parcel that spans nearly an acre, just a short jaunt away from Las Flores Beach, the boxy contemporary structure was originally built in 1979. It’s since undergone a complete renovation; inside, five bedrooms and an equal number of baths are spread across more than 2,600 square feet of light-filled living space featuring new systems, finishes and fixtures.
Highlights of the two-story residence include a combo living/dining room adorned with a fireplace, which connects to a sleekly designed kitchen outfitted with newer appliances and an eat-in island. Outdoors, the grounds are private and free from houses on either side. Amenities include a grassy backyard, barbecue area, and plenty of spots for al fresco dining and lounging. There’s also a two-car garage out front.
No word on where the boys will be hanging their hats next, but it won’t be at their mom’s longtime Malibu Colony spread. She sold that place last year for $11.8 million to furniture company CEO Loren Kreiss and relocated to Canada, where she now lives at her grandmother’s former property on Vancouver Island.
Cooper Mount of The Agency served as the listing agent; Brooke Rippner and Valerie Fitzgerald of Coldwell Banker Realty repped the buyer.
